#69b44c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69b44c is composed of 41.2% red, 70.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.8%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 103.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.9% and a lightness of 50.2%. #69b44c color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ff98 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

● #69b44c color description : Moderate green.
#69b44c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69b44c has RGB values of R:105, G:180,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6927436.

Shades and Tints of #69b44c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f4faf2 is the lightest one.
